In "The Voyages and Adventures of Captain Hatteras," Jules Verne weaves a compelling narrative that explores the themes of exploration, courage, and the indomitable human spirit amidst the unforgiving landscapes of the North Pole. This novel, written in Verne's signature blend of rich descriptive language and thrilling adventure, stands as a landmark in science fiction literature. It not only captivates readers with its detailed depictions of maritime exploits and perilous journeys but also engages with the scientific knowledge of the era, reflecting the Victorian fascination with geography and the unknown. Through Captain Hatteras's obsessive quest to reach the pole, Verne examines the nature of leadership and the impacts of ambition on human relationships, positioning the novel within the framework of 19th-century imperialism and exploration narratives. Jules Verne (1828-1905), often heralded as a pioneer of the science fiction genre, was deeply influenced by the technological advancements and exploratory spirit of his time. Raised in a maritime city and drawing inspiration from contemporary scientific discoveries, Verne's passion for adventure and knowledge permeated his works. "The Voyages and Adventures of Captain Hatteras" reveals Verne's own fascination with the Arctic, as he intertwines personal ambition with a critique of colonialism and scientific hubris. This novel is essential for readers drawn to the intersection of adventure and intellectual inquiry. Verne's masterful storytelling and complex characters invite readers to immerse themselves in a thrilling journey through uncharted territories and existential dilemmas. As contemporary readers navigate their own quests for understanding in an age of exploration, Verne'Äôs work remains relevant, urging a reconsideration of human ambition and its consequences.
